The global eHealth market has witnessed significant growth in recent years, driven by the increasing adoption of digital technologies and the need for efficient healthcare systems. eHealth, also known as electronic health, refers to the use of information and communication technologies (ICT) in healthcare delivery, management, and monitoring. It encompasses a wide range of applications, including electronic health records (EHR), telemedicine, mobile health (mHealth), health information exchange (HIE), and healthcare analytics. The eHealth market is revolutionizing healthcare by improving access to medical information, enhancing patient care, and optimizing healthcare processes.

eHealth, short for electronic health, is a broad term that encompasses the use of digital technologies in healthcare. It involves the electronic storage, exchange, and management of health-related information, as well as the delivery of healthcare services through digital platforms. eHealth technologies include electronic health records (EHRs), telemedicine, wearable devices, mobile applications, and healthcare analytics. These technologies enable healthcare providers, patients, and other stakeholders to access and share information, communicate remotely, and monitor health conditions effectively.

Category-wise Insights

  1. Electronic Health Records (EHR)
    • EHR systems enable the digital storage and management of patient health information.
    • They enhance healthcare efficiency, patient safety, and care coordination among healthcare providers.
  2. Telemedicine
    • Telemedicine allows remote consultation and diagnosis of patients through audio, video, and digital communication technologies.
    • It provides access to healthcare services for patients in remote areas and enables specialists to reach a broader patient base.
  3. Mobile Health (mHealth) Apps
    • mHealth apps are mobile applications that facilitate health monitoring, wellness tracking, and access to healthcare information.
    • They empower patients to actively participate in their own healthcare and enable healthcare professionals to remotely monitor patient health.
  4. Healthcare Analytics
    • Healthcare analytics involves the collection, analysis, and interpretation of healthcare data to improve decision-making and healthcare outcomes.
    • It enables healthcare providers to identify patterns, predict trends, and make informed decisions for population health management.

Covid-19 Impact

The COVID-19 pandemic has significantly accelerated the adoption of eHealth technologies. With social distancing measures and the need to minimize in-person healthcare visits, telemedicine and virtual consultations became essential for continuity of care. The pandemic highlighted the importance of remote patient monitoring, digital health records, and telehealth solutions. The eHealth market experienced rapid growth during this time, with increased investments in digital healthcare infrastructure and the implementation of new eHealth solutions to address the challenges posed by the pandemic.
